Located in Chișinău, Republic of Moldova, SOL is a landmark dining destination designed to merge timeless tradition with bold modernity. The restaurant spans over 26,000 sq. ft. across three architecturally distinct floors, each curated to evoke the soul of hospitality, warmth, and shared experience.
Design Concept
SOL takes inspiration from the mythological solar deity who embodies warmth, light, and life. This mythic energy is channeled into every design detail—from the central solar tower that anchors the space, to custom-crafted furniture and ancient-inspired murals that narrate the restaurant’s story.
The design seamlessly fuses Art Deco, loft, and steampunk elements with contemporary aesthetics. Textured concrete, rusted metal, natural stone, and tactile wood form the material palette, while hues of sun-soaked amber, ochre, and gold suffuse the interiors with a radiant warmth.
Spatial Experience
Ground Floor: A dramatic bar crowned by a soaring solar tower sets the tone. Deco-patterned metalwork and sculptural lighting evoke celestial grandeur.
Second Floor: Intimate cocktail zones and curated tasting rooms framed by sun god murals and bespoke furnishings. A dual-sided wine display acts as a functional divider and visual centerpiece.
Third Floor: A summer terrace adorned with natural planks and raw stone overlooks La Izvor Park. Cozy lounge-style seating invites long conversations under the sky.
Culinary Identity
SOL’s cuisine is as layered as its interiors—where Mediterranean and Balkan roots meet contemporary technique. Open-fire cooking takes center stage, echoing the hearth at the heart of ancient homes. The menu encourages exploration, from comfort classics to molecular innovation.
